Espescially when you look at the 3970010 block. Lists it as 302 Z28, 327 trucks, and 350 2 and 4 bolt main 69 to 80. That covers just about every 350 built between 69 to 80. The engine stamp code at the right front of the block would be the better more acurate way of decifering final assembly installation.
